FX has released some new “American Horror Story: 1984” promos, and the ninth season on FX looks awesome.

The plot of the new season is as follows, according to the YouTube description:

In the summer of 1984, five friends escape Los Angeles to work as counselors at Camp Redwood. As they adjust to their new jobs, they quickly learn that the only thing scarier than campfire tales is the past coming to haunt you. American Horror Story: 1984 is the ninth installment of the award-winning anthology series created by Ryan Murphy and Brad Falchuk.

In the latest promos, we’re still getting heavy “Friday the 13th” vibes. In one promo, a woman crawls for a phone as a guy with a massive weapons appears. I’m going to guess she doesn’t make it.

In the second one, a woman is attempting to flee in a vehicle when the killer shows up. You can give them both a watch below. (RELATED: Watch ‘American Horror Story: 1984′ Teaser Trailer)
